About Huddersfield Town Hall

Huddersfield Town Hall is a municipal, Grade II-listed venue renowned for its dedicated Concert Hall, conferences, weddings, and cultural performances. With a seating configuration adaptable to each show, the Concert Hall seats up to 1,200 people, offering an intimate yet expansive setting for a wide range of events. The entrance on Corporation Street leads guests into a historic building that remains a cornerstone of Huddersfield’s arts scene.

Good to know

Seating, Parking & Venue Information

  • Capacity: Concert Hall seats up to 1,200 (seating configurations vary; plan shows total capacity around 1,200).
  • Address: Huddersfield Town Hall, Ramsden Street, Huddersfield, HD1 2TA; entrance on Corporation Street.
  • Venue type: Municipal Grade II-listed building with a dedicated concert hall, used for events, conferences and weddings.
  • Seating chart: Official seating plan PDF available (Huddersfield Town Hall Concert Plan) showing layout and capacity.
  • Parking/transport: Limited on-site parking; nearby Civic Centre car park and Springwood car park; paid parking nearby; 10-minute walk from Huddersfield Train Station; 5-minute walk from Huddersfield Bus Station.
  • Nearby hotels: Several close by, e.g., Premier Inn Huddersfield Central and Stay Hotel/Huddersfield area options listed via Yorkshire travel guides.
  • Notable events hosted: Massed Bands Concert (Brighouse & Rastrick Band) at Huddersfield Town Hall; Angie’s Disco Orchestra festival takeover (July 2024); town hall also used as a venue for Huddersfield Contemporary Music Festival events.
  • Demolished/renamed: Not demolished or renamed; continues to operate as Huddersfield Town Hall.
